πŸ₯ Facility Summary

Good Samaritan Society - Mountain Lake is a 4-star nursing home in MOUNTAIN LAKE, MN with 48 beds.

What is the quality rating of Good Samaritan Society - Mountain Lake?
Good Samaritan Society - Mountain Lake has a 4-star rating out of 5 from CMS. This is an above-average rating, indicating better quality care compared to most nursing homes. The rating is based on health inspections, staffing levels, and quality measures.
When was Good Samaritan Society - Mountain Lake last inspected?
Inspection reports are documented by state survey agencies and the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S). Reports typically lag 2-3 months behind the actual inspection date. Visit the facility's full profile page for detailed violation information and inspection history.
